The Impala 36 jensen is a 36.09ft fractional sloop designed by E. Bjørn Jensen and built in fiberglass since 1985.

The Impala 36 jensen is a light sailboat which is a good performer. It is very stable / stiff and has a low righting capability if capsized. It is best suited as a coastal cruiser. The fuel capacity is originally very small. There is a very short water supply range.
